On 03/23/2016 02:25 PM, Andrzej Hajda wrote:
> HDMI-PHY clock should be accessible from other components in the pipeline.
>
> Signed-off-by: Andrzej Hajda <a.hajda@samsung.com>
> ---
> drivers/gpu/drm/exynos/exynos_hdmi.c | 67 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++----------
> 1 file changed, 48 insertions(+), 19 deletions(-)
>
> di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/exynos/exynos_hdmi.c b/drivers/gpu/drm/exynos/exynos_hdmi.c
> index 49a5902..0d1c2f0 100644
> --- a/drivers/gpu/drm/exynos/exynos_hdmi.c
> +++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/exynos/exynos_hdmi.c
> @@ -146,6 +146,7 @@ struct hdmi_context {
> struct clk **clk_muxes;
> struct regulator_bulk_data regul_bulk[ARRAY_SIZE(supply)];
> struct regulator *reg_hdmi_en;
> + struct exynos_drm_clk phy_clk;
> };
>
> static inline struct hdmi_context *encoder_to_hdmi(struct drm_encoder *e)
> @@ -1448,7 +1449,6 @@ static void hdmiphy_conf_apply(struct hdmi_context *hdata)
>
> static void hdmi_conf_apply(struct hdmi_context *hdata)
> {
> - hdmiphy_conf_apply(hdata);
> hdmi_start(hdata, false);
> hdmi_conf_init(hdata);
> hdmi_audio_init(hdata);
> @@ -1481,10 +1481,8 @@ static void hdmi_set_refclk(struct hdmi_context *hdata, bool on)
> SYSREG_HDMI_REFCLK_INT_CLK, on ? ~0 : 0);
> }
>
> -static void hdmi_enable(struct drm_encoder *encoder)
> +static void hdmiphy_enable(struct hdmi_context *hdata)
> {
> - struct hdmi_context *hdata = encoder_to_hdmi(encoder);
> -
> if (hdata->powered)
> return;
>
> @@ -1500,11 +1498,40 @@ static void hdmi_enable(struct drm_encoder *encoder)
>
> hdmi_reg_writemask(hdata, HDMI_PHY_CON_0, 0, HDMI_PHY_POWER_OFF_EN);
>
> - hdmi_conf_apply(hdata);
> + hdmiphy_conf_apply(hdata);
>
> hdata->powered = true;
> }
>
> +static void hdmiphy_disable(struct hdmi_context *hdata)
> +{
> + if (!hdata->powered)
> + return;
> +
> + hdmi_reg_writemask(hdata, HDMI_CON_0, 0, HDMI_EN);
> +
> + hdmi_reg_writemask(hdata, HDMI_PHY_CON_0, ~0, HDMI_PHY_POWER_OFF_EN);
> +
> + hdmi_set_refclk(hdata, false);
> +
> + regmap_update_bits(hdata->pmureg, PMU_HDMI_PHY_CONTROL,
> + PMU_HDMI_PHY_ENABLE_BIT, 0);
> +
> + regulator_bulk_disable(ARRAY_SIZE(supply), hdata->regul_bulk);
> +
> + pm_runtime_put_sync(hdata->dev);
> +
> + hdata->powered = false;
> +}
> +
> +static void hdmi_enable(struct drm_encoder *encoder)
> +{
> + struct hdmi_context *hdata = encoder_to_hdmi(encoder);
> +
> + hdmiphy_enable(hdata);
> + hdmi_conf_apply(hdata);
> +}
> +
> static void hdmi_disable(struct drm_encoder *encoder)
> {
> struct hdmi_context *hdata = encoder_to_hdmi(encoder);
> @@ -1528,22 +1555,9 @@ static void hdmi_disable(struct drm_encoder *encoder)
> if (funcs && funcs->disable)
> (*funcs->disable)(crtc);
>
> - hdmi_reg_writemask(hdata, HDMI_CON_0, 0, HDMI_EN);
> -
> cancel_delayed_work(&hdata->hotplug_work);
>
> - hdmi_reg_writemask(hdata, HDMI_PHY_CON_0, ~0, HDMI_PHY_POWER_OFF_EN);
> -
> - hdmi_set_refclk(hdata, false);
> -
> - regmap_update_bits(hdata->pmureg, PMU_HDMI_PHY_CONTROL,
> - PMU_HDMI_PHY_ENABLE_BIT, 0);
> -
> - regulator_bulk_disable(ARRAY_SIZE(supply), hdata->regul_bulk);
> -
> - pm_runtime_put_sync(hdata->dev);
> -
> - hdata->powered = false;
> + hdmiphy_disable(hdata);
> }
>
> static const struct drm_encoder_helper_funcs exynos_hdmi_encoder_helper_funcs = {
> @@ -1627,6 +1641,17 @@ static int hdmi_clk_init(struct hdmi_context *hdata)
> return hdmi_clks_get(hdata, &drv_data->clk_muxes, hdata->clk_muxes);
> }
>
> +static void hdmiphy_clk_enable(struct exynos_drm_clk *clk, bool enable)
> +{
> + struct hdmi_context *hdata = container_of(clk, struct hdmi_context,
> + phy_clk);
> +
> + if (enable)
> + hdmiphy_enable(hdata);
> + else
> + hdmiphy_disable(hdata);
> +}
> +
> static int hdmi_resources_init(struct hdmi_context *hdata)
> {
> struct device *dev = hdata->dev;
> @@ -1710,6 +1735,10 @@ static int hdmi_bind(struct device *dev, struct device *master, void *data)
> if (pipe < 0)
> return pipe;
>
> + hdata->phy_clk.enable = hdmiphy_clk_enable;
> +
> + exynos_drm_crtc_from_pipe(drm_dev, pipe)->pipe_clk = &hdata->phy_clk;
> +
> encoder->possible_crtcs = 1 << pipe;
>
> DRM_DEBUG_KMS("possible_crtcs = 0x%x\n", encoder->possible_crtcs);
>
